Step-by-Step Process to Clean Your Water Bottle Using Vinegar and Baking Soda
Start by rinsing the water bottle with warm water to remove any loose debris or residue. This initial rinse prepares the surface for deeper cleaning and ensures that the vinegar and baking soda can work effectively.
Next, pour about one to two tablespoons of baking soda into the water bottle. Baking soda acts as a mild abrasive and deodorizer, helping to lift stains and neutralize odors without damaging the bottle’s material.
Add one cup of white vinegar slowly into the bottle. The vinegar will react with the baking soda, causing fizzing that helps break down mineral buildup, mold, and bacteria. This natural chemical reaction also reaches into hard-to-clean corners and crevices.
Allow the mixture to fizz and sit inside the bottle for at least 15 to 30 minutes. This soaking period is crucial for loosening stubborn grime and sanitizing the interior surfaces.
After soaking, use a bottle brush to scrub the inside thoroughly. Focus on the bottom and the neck of the bottle, where residues and biofilm tend to accumulate. The combination of vinegar and baking soda will have softened these deposits, making scrubbing more effective.
Once scrubbing is complete, rinse the bottle thoroughly with warm water to remove all traces of vinegar, baking soda, and loosened debris. Residual baking soda can leave a gritty texture, so ensure the bottle is well rinsed.
Finally, air dry the bottle with the cap off to prevent moisture buildup, which can encourage mold growth. Keeping your bottle dry between uses helps maintain cleanliness longer.
Additional Tips and Precautions for Using Vinegar and Baking Soda
While vinegar and baking soda provide an eco-friendly and effective cleaning method, it’s important to consider the following tips to optimize results and protect your water bottle:
- Use distilled white vinegar, as other types of vinegar may stain or leave unwanted residues.
- Avoid using this cleaning method on bottles made of delicate materials like aluminum or those with special coatings, as vinegar’s acidity might cause corrosion or damage.
- For bottles with narrow openings, use a long-handled bottle brush or a pipe cleaner to reach all internal surfaces.
- Perform this cleaning routine once a week if you use your water bottle daily, or more frequently if you notice odors or buildup.
- Rinse thoroughly to prevent any residual taste from vinegar or baking soda, which can affect the flavor of your water.

Maintenance Tips to Keep Your Water Bottle Fresh
To prolong the cleanliness and freshness of your water bottle after cleaning, consider these maintenance practices:
- Always empty and rinse your bottle after each use to prevent bacterial growth.
- Store the bottle with the cap off to allow air circulation and drying.
- Avoid leaving sugary or flavored drinks in the bottle for extended periods, as these can encourage mold and residue buildup.
- Occasionally inspect the bottle’s seals and lids for mold or damage, cleaning these parts separately with vinegar and baking soda if necessary.
- For stainless steel bottles, avoid harsh scrubbing that can damage the finish; instead, rely on soaking and gentle brushing.
